
It’s often the case though that we use the concept of MVP outside the discovery phase. When we do we need to be wary. Delivering production ready, customer facing product under the name “MVP” can fundamentally undermine the product. In this scenario, It’s quite possible that the minimum will win over the viable, and if we avoid that scenario, then the best outcome is the viable winning over what could be truly desirable.
